Cross-Training That Extends Your Accrington Dog's Career

Working and sport dogs face a brutal reality: the very training that makes them excellent eventually breaks them down. Repetitive impact wears cartilage, overloads tendons, and creates muscular imbalances that lead to injury. Cross-training in the pool is how careful handlers extend active careers by years.

Swimming sessions complement land training without adding cumulative wear. Many Lancashire agility, gun dog, and working line handlers schedule weekly pool sessions specifically to recover from intense weekends and rebuild before the next event. The dogs stay sounder, longer.

"What happens if my dog has an accident in the pool?"

It happens and it's not a problem! Our filtration system handles it quickly and we're well prepared. We ask that dogs are walked before sessions and we recommend not feeding them within 2 hours of swimming.

"How often should an active dog swim?"

For peak fitness, weekly is ideal — twice weekly during pre-season conditioning. For maintenance, fortnightly works well alongside normal walks. We're happy to suggest a schedule based on your dog's activity level.
